Brisc is growing fast. Our customers are MGAs and delegated-authority programs, reinsurers, specialty carriers and mutuals, with books across North America, Bermuda and London. Each one runs its back office differently.
Our AI Analysts handle reconciliation, bordereaux, submissions and claims, and go live in 2 to 6 weeks. Your job is to make that happen for each new customer.
You’ll learn how a customer’s team works, then set up the Analyst to match: data mappings, matching rules and tolerances. When results come back wrong, you’ll figure out why and fix it. Over the first few months, the match rate climbs.
You stay with each customer after go-live. Their results are yours to own.
Customers typically start around 80% matched on day one and reach 92 to 95% by about 90 days. Your work is a big part of getting them there.
